Description of Dissemination Event:

UNIBO has organized the UMBRELLA ORGANIZATION MEETING in web conference on meets.
The event was entirely dedicated to professionals and its focus was to share the new draft of professional module and to go deep in some technical context issues with three different speeches by HERA, Nomistaenergia and Prometeia.
At the end of the meeting we have submitted a survey in order to collect feedbacks from the professional world useful for the next steps of GrEnFIn project.

In line with the key elements of the Innovation Union and the EU Higher Education Modernisation Agenda, the GrEnFIn Erasmus+/Knowledge Alliance project aims to provide the Energy Sector's stakeholders (energy providers, private companies, research institutes) the figure of the Sustainable Energy experts professional, i.e. European high skilled professionals capable to face the changing challenges in the field with an inclusive global logic. Its main expected results are the development of an innovative Joint Master Degree in the Green Energy and Finance targeting young students, but also a Professional Module to train companies' staff and experts already active in the labor market.
